Transaction 2caa4589bae05e6ca050d2c3a01833045adb5a5bcb855a80c8708132d54c8594

1 Input
2 Outputs
  • 2caa4589bae05e6ca050d2c3a01833045adb5a5bcb855a80c8708132d54c8594:0
  • value  67527818015
    address  3DDMCDx3EC68XimLyxfaguE8S6ZdZcAWKH
  • 2caa4589bae05e6ca050d2c3a01833045adb5a5bcb855a80c8708132d54c8594:1
  • value  14324300100
    address  33aCxGixxG539GaELMu3BYGHXyoxB8hteG